Annual Potomac River Festival CANCELED

Town Hill Colonial Avenue & Washington Ave, Colonial Beach, VA, United States

A time-honored Colonial Beach tradition honoring the history and the bounty of the Potomac River.  The Colonial Beach Volunteer Department sponsor the events on Friday which begins with the Firemen's Parade…reputed to be the loudest parade in Virginia!  After the parade the beauty pageant takes place on the Town Stage.
